Scots road. The "distinctive" pink and purple cage was discovered by a passing motorist on the A909 between Kelty and Cowdenbeath in Fife.

Three adult hamsters and one new-born pinkie hamster were found.Tragically, two other pinkie hamsters were discovered dead amongst the bedding.The Scottish SPCA is investigating the incident, with the cute critters now being taken care of at one of their animal rehoming centres.

Inspector Robyn Gray from the animal charity urged anyone with information to come forward, as hamsters should not be left by the side of the road.She said: “The hamsters were left in a distinctive pink and purple cage at the side of the road.“The A909 is a busy thoroughfare and our hope is that other drivers may have seen the.
